Output f6fc314263aba62c0fe70a0fff6b7e2f4d5f00384956543a3a69012980327ddb:4

value
2108020569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5d3b2cc4a99853ed0f4adcf2de12c999da9984d OP_EQUAL
address
3JGRqL5nXeZ945DHg6MA8hhc1qhkAzru6L
transaction
f6fc314263aba62c0fe70a0fff6b7e2f4d5f00384956543a3a69012980327ddb
spent
true